Councilors approved a secondhand-articles license, two garage/flammable-storage transfers, and two change-of-control requests for local businesses; change-of-control petitions were approved by roll call.

The Brockton City Council on Sept. 8 granted several routine business licensing requests and approved two change-of-control filings for local businesses.
